Inna Ganschow is a German author and researcher known for her historical work, "Keiner weinte, es gab keine Tränen mehr," which examines the lives of Soviet forced laborers in Luxembourg during World War II. She was recently awarded the "Lëtzebuerger Buchpräis" in the non-fiction category for her contribution to shedding light on a marginalized group affected by the Nazi regime.
